Finding the Perfect Wood Cabinetry for Maximum Efficiency

Wood cabinetry is more than just a storage solution; it is an essential element of interior design that defines the overall appeal of a space. Here are some key aspects to consider when aiming for maximum efficiency in your wood cabinetry:

1. Assessing Your Needs and Space

To begin the journey towards ideal wood cabinetry, analyze your requirements and the available space. Are you looking for kitchen cabinets, bathroom storage, or cabinets for your living room? Measure the available space, including height, width, and depth, to ensure that the cabinets you choose fit perfectly.

2. Choosing the Right Wood Type

The wood type plays a crucial role in the durability and aesthetics of your cabinetry. Opt for hardwoods like oak, maple, or cherry, as they are robust and long-lasting. These woods also offer a variety of beautiful finishes to complement your interior design.

4. Customizing Your Cabinetry

Custom-built cabinetry allows you to tailor the design according to your specific needs and preferences. Consider factors like shelving configurations, drawer inserts, and pull-out trays to optimize storage and organization.

5. Designing for Functionality

Efficient cabinetry should prioritize functionality. Think about the daily usage and accessibility of items. Incorporate features like soft-close drawers and adjustable shelves to improve usability.

6. Utilizing Vertical Space

Don’t let the vertical space in your cabinetry go to waste. Install tall cabinets that reach the ceiling to maximize storage. Utilize the top shelves for items you rarely use, and keep frequently used items within easy reach.

7. Installing Pull-Out Storage

Optimize cabinet space by incorporating pull-out racks and shelves. These allow you to access items stored at the back of the cabinet without any hassle, making your cabinetry highly efficient.

8. Adding Built-In Organizers

Built-in organizers are perfect for keeping your cabinetry clutter-free. Incorporate dividers, trays, and compartments to categorize and store various items efficiently.

9. Blending Functionality with Aesthetics

While functionality is essential, aesthetics also play a crucial role in making your cabinetry visually appealing. Choose door styles, hardware, and finishes that complement your interior design.

10. Maximizing Kitchen Cabinet Efficiency

The kitchen is one of the busiest areas in a home, and efficient cabinetry is particularly crucial in this space. Consider incorporating features like lazy susans, spice pull-outs, and trash bin cabinets to streamline your kitchen tasks.

11. Exploring Cabinetry Lighting Options

Effective lighting can significantly enhance the functionality and visual appeal of your cabinetry. Explore options like under-cabinet lighting, interior LED lights, and sensor-activated lights for ease of use.

12. Selecting Hardware and Accessories

The hardware and accessories you choose can make a significant difference in your cabinetry’s efficiency. Opt for high-quality, durable handles, knobs, and hinges that complement your design and ensure smooth operation.

FAQs

Q: How do I determine the best wood type for my cabinetry?

A: Consider factors like durability, appearance, and budget when choosing the right wood type. Hardwoods like oak, maple, and cherry are popular choices due to their sturdiness and beauty.

Q: What are some practical ways to maximize kitchen cabinet efficiency?

A: Incorporate features like lazy susans, pull-out trays, and spice pull-outs. Utilize the vertical space by installing tall cabinets that reach the ceiling.

Q: How can I keep my wood cabinetry looking its best?

A: Regularly clean your cabinets with a mild soap solution and a soft cloth.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that can damage the wood finish.

Q: Are there eco-friendly wood options for cabinetry?

A: Yes, sustainable wood options like bamboo, reclaimed wood, and FSC-certified wood are excellent choices for eco-conscious homeowners.

Q: Can I customize my cabinetry to suit my specific needs?

A: Absolutely! Custom-built cabinetry allows you to tailor the design to fit your exact requirements and maximize efficiency.

Q: What’s the difference between framed and frameless cabinets?

A: Framed cabinets have a front frame around the cabinet opening, while frameless cabinets don’t. Frameless cabinets offer more storage space but require precise installation.
